  • “Hands-free” access devices of the kind mentioned above are now well known, see for example DE 198 36 957 C. They are used in particular in the automotive industry to control the locking and the unlocking the doors of a motor vehicle and possibly also, to control a device for immobilizing the vehicle automobile.
  • "hands-free" access devices are not limited to such a field of application because they can be used as well to control the unlocking of a door of a building or a building, to which access must be limited to one or more person (s) authorized to enter the said building or premises.
  • Known "hands-free" access devices use usually a radiofrequency communication link, for example example at 125 kHz to communicate the vehicle to the identifier carried by the driver or a passenger of the vehicle, the response of the identifier to the vehicle being returned by the same link radio frequency or an ultra high communication link frequency (UHF), for example in one of the frequency bands Such as the bands 315 MHz, 433 MHz, 868 MHz, 915 MHz and 2.4 GHz.

  • the communication link or links have a useful range of a few meters at least, so that the doors of the vehicle can only be unlocked if the authorized person carrying the identifier is located near the vehicle in a zone corresponding to said useful range, and the doors of the vehicle are locked automatically when the authorized person leaves this zoned.
  • the various transmitting antennas connected to the device on-board identification are generally used to allow a location of the authorized person the identifier, especially to determine if it is inside outside the vehicle and, in the case where it is outside the vehicle, vehicle to determine whether it is on the left or the side right or at the rear of the vehicle near the luggage compartment or tailgate of said vehicle.
  • the identifier carried by the authorized person contains the most often three receiving antennas oriented respectively according to three axes of a system of orthogonal axes of reference. Such a provision is usually made to avoid "holes in receipt "which, if the identifier had only one antenna receiver, could occur in the event that said identifier presents certain orientations in relation to the antenna (s) transmitter (s) transmitting the signal generated by the identification device embedded in the vehicle, even if the identifier is in the zone corresponding to the effective range of said transmitting antennas. With a identifier comprising three receiving antennas oriented as indicated above, it is virtually certain that at least one of the three receiving antennas will receive a signal from the transmitting antenna (s).
  • the present invention therefore aims to provide another solution to the problem of hacking a "hands-free" access device whatever the type of its communication link, radiofrequency or UHF, but preferably radiofrequency.
  • the access device "hands free" is characterized in that said means for processing signals comprises a discriminating means capable of distinguishing whether the fields received by said receiving antennas are from said transmitting antennas or a single pirate transmitter antenna, for allow a response from the identifier to the means of identification in the first case and prohibit said answer in the second case.
  • the basic principle of the present invention is to use the three-dimensional capacity of the antenna network of certain identifiers with several receiving antennas, in order to define with accuracy the orientation and possibly the amplitude of a field given, for example at 125 kHz, according to its origin in the vehicle.
  • a vehicle 1 equipped with a "hands free” access device comprising essentially an identification device 2, installed aboard the vehicle, and an identifier 3 intended to be worn by the driver of the vehicle or another person authorized to drive the vehicle or to enter.
  • the identification device 2 is electrically connected to several transmitting antennas which are spaced from each other on the bodywork of the motor vehicle.
  • it can be provided two front lateral emitting antennas F and F ', arranged respectively on the left and right sides of vehicle 1, two rear-side transmitting antennas R and R 'arranged respectively on the left and right side of the vehicle, and a transmitting antenna rear T, disposed substantially in the middle of the hood 4 of the trunk luggage.
  • the antennas F and F ' are installed for example on the doors before 5 and 6 of the vehicle 1, for example at the handles of exterior door.
  • the antennas R and R ' are installed for example on the rear doors 7 and 8 of the vehicle, for example at the level of exterior door handles.
  • All the antennas F, F ', R, R' and T can be constituted for example by coils, the coils F, F ', R and R' having their axes oriented for example horizontally or substantially horizontally and the coil T having for example its axis oriented vertically or substantially vertically.
  • the antennas or coils F, F ', R, R' and T When the antennas or coils F, F ', R, R' and T are excited at a predefined frequency, for example at 125 kHz, by excitation means included in the identification device 2, they produce magnetic fields whose field lines are designated by the symbols LCF, LCF ', LCR, LCR' and LCT in Figure 1.

  • the identifier 3 which can be for example included in a keychain or constituted by a badge having the format of a card of credit, carry at least two receiving antennas, preferably three receiving antennas not shown in Figure 1, but designated respectively by X, Y and Z in Figures 2 to 4.
  • the three antennas X, Y and Z for example coils, are preferably oriented respectively along the three axes of a system of orthogonal axes of reference linked to the identifier 3.
  • the latter also includes, so known per se, a means for processing the electrical signals produced by antennas X, Y and Z in response to the magnetic fields received by these from one or more of the transmitting antennas F, F ', R, R' and T installed on the vehicle 1.
  • This means of treatment signal is arranged to control the transmission, by one or more antennas X, Y and Z or by a specific antenna, information, such as a user code, to the device identification number 2 in the motor vehicle 1.
  • the signal processing means further includes, as as we shall see below, a discriminating means capable of distinguishing a short time window if the magnetic fields received by the three receiving antennas X, Y and Z of the identifier 3 have orientations as they come from the transmitting antennas of the vehicle 1 or if the magnetic field comes from a single antenna.
  • the single antenna is considered as a source hacker and the signal processing means inhibits the transmission of information from the identifier 3 to the identification device 2.
  • the means discriminator included in the signal processing means of the identifier 3 is arranged to determine that of the three antennas receptors X, Y and Z which, at a given moment, produces the strongest signal.
  • the discriminator means may be constituted for example by the specific integrated circuit (properly programmed microprocessor) usually included in identifier 3. Such an integrated circuit has most often such a function of discrimination but in the known handsfree access devices this function is usually used to keep and treat only the strongest of the three signals received by the receiving antennas.
  • the excitation means included in the device 2 are arranged to excite at least two of the antennas transmitters installed on the vehicle 1, preferably three antennas transmitters according to a predefined sequence in a time window predefined.
  • the excitation means can excite any first the three antennas F, R and T according to said predefined sequence in a first time window, then the three transmitting antennas F ', R' and T according to said predefined sequence or another sequence predefined in a next time window, and finally the three transmitting antennas R, R 'and T according to said predefined sequence or yet another predefined sequence in a third window time.

  • the discriminator means included in identifier 3 may then, in service, compare the sequence of the strongest signals received by the receiving antennas X, Y and Z in response to sequential excitation transmitting antennas F, R and T, to the sequences recorded in in the memory, and if the sequence of the strongest signals receipts corresponds to one of the recorded sequences, he will deduce that the magnetic fields received from the transmitting antennas vehicle, and it will then allow the identifier to send a reply to the motor vehicle 1.
  • the discriminating means could be content with determine that it receives in sequence, in a time window predefined, stronger signals received by multiple antennas receiving.
  • identifier 3 is in the field generated by a single emitting source, like this would be the case with a relay box pirate, the receiving antenna which produces the strongest signal will remain permanently the same, that is to say either the X antenna, the Y antenna or the Z antenna during the short time window corresponding to an expected transmission sequence 1. Consequently, in this situation, the means discriminator will determine that the signal received is a pirate signal and he prevent the identifier from responding to the received pirate signal, and the system relay can not relay any response to the device identification on board the vehicle, so that the doors of it will remain locked.
  • the antennas transmitters F, F ', R, R' and T emit at the same frequency, by example at 125 kHz.
  • antennas receptors should be tuned in frequency, although this is not not imperative for the transmission of information (taking into account manufacturing tolerances, the resonance frequencies of the antennas are generally within ⁇ 10% of the nominal frequency).
  • the identification device 2 can be advantageously provided with means to scan the frequencies emitted by the transmitting antennas around a predefined center frequency, for example around 125 kHz, so that the transmitted frequency goes through the frequency resonance of each of the X, Y and Z receiving antennas. also possible to deliberately detune antennas receivers and / or transmitters to improve the efficiency of the discrimination.
